Bharat College of Law Admission Process 2025
The Bharat College of Law admission process is mostly merit-based. To get a seat, students need to go through all the steps as per guidelines. Bharat College of Law offers UG and PG level courses. Candidates are shortlisted for the programmes based on their academic merit and past academic scores. The process starts with registration.

Bharat College of Law B.A. LL.B. (Hons) Admission 2025
Bharat College of Law admissions are on a merit basis and students need not appear for any entrance test. The duration of the programme is 5 years.
Eligible candidates can submit the required documents and register for the course. Below is the eligibility to join Bharat College of Law:

Bharat College of Law LL.B. Admission 2025
Bharat College of Law LL.B. is offered to candidates at the UG level. Candidates are required to participate in the entrance-based admission process to be considered for the final admission offer. Candidates are shortlisted for the LL.B. programme based on their performance in the entrance exam. Candidates who qualify in the admission process are eligible to secure their seat in the 3 years programme.
